On this episode of Stock Movers:
- AMD (AMD) shares soar after the company signed a deal with OpenAI for AI infrastructure that could generate tens of billions of dollars in new revenue.
- Micron (MU) shares rise after Morgan Stanley upgraded the company to overweight from equal-weight saying the chipmaker is headed for multiple quarters of double-digit price increases.
- Verizon (VZ) shares fall after the company named Dan Schulman chief executive officer, replacing Hans Vestberg effective immediately. Vestberg will stay on through Oct. 4, 2026 to help ensure a smooth transition in leadership, including the integration with Frontier Communications.
